Friedrich Carl Eichenroth
|
75676ab8e1
|
Profiling-helper (#2321)
* change profiler
* remove unused imports
* remove unused imports
* change lazybuffer references
* remove unused line
* remove unused import
* remove unused stuff
* add types
* typing
* typing
* typing
* trigger actions
* -1 loc
* fixup
* trigger actions
* revert lazy typing changes
* WIP profiler helper
* replace old start & stop profiler
* fixup
* linting
* Update llama.py
---------
Co-authored-by: George Hotz <72895+geohot@users.noreply.github.com>
|
2023-11-16 14:15:56 -08:00 |
|
George Hotz
|
15da96f393
|
print test durations and add speed (#2107)
* print test durations
* decrease sizes to increase speed
* faster
* GPU/CLANG onnx in seperate runner
* test split, move ONNX CPU CI
* simpler tests
* simpler uops test
* faster
* less cuda apt
* running ninja install
* apt install
* split fancy indexing
|
2023-10-18 13:46:42 -07:00 |
|
George Hotz
|
121f7aa8c5
|
Schedule item (#2012)
* ScheduleItem
* put var_vals in the schedule
* fix tests, wow that proliferated quickly
* not ready to be in the schedule
|
2023-10-07 08:59:25 -07:00 |
|
George Hotz
|
f54959e5cd
|
move print tree into graph (#2003)
* move print tree into graph
* add winograd profiling test
* change pre-commit to run ruff first
|
2023-10-07 04:39:21 -07:00 |
|
George Hotz
|
a677a1e2cd
|
winograd test prints op count
|
2023-09-29 05:41:29 -07:00 |
|
George Hotz
|
81cb120b0f
|
winograd speed test (#1942)
|
2023-09-29 04:40:35 -07:00 |
|